In the past, in order to maintain multiple correspondences, top platform creators hired so-called “chatters” – specialists who corresponded with fans, creating the illusion of face-to-face interaction. These employees were often located in low-wage countries such as the Philippines, Pakistan and India. But as technology advances, more and more of these tasks are being outsourced to artificial intelligence.

Startups like ChatPersona offer AI solutions to automate conversations on OnlyFans. ChatPersona, for example, trains its models on real-world correspondence data and provides a tool that generates messages, requiring only that a person press the “send” button. This technically circumvents the platform’s rules, although OnlyFans has previously banned the use of chatbots.

Since launching last year, ChatPersona has already attracted around 6,000 customers, including individual creators and agencies. According to founder Kunal Anand, the demand for such technology is growing rapidly.

What AI tools are being used?”

The AI market for OnlyFans is quickly becoming saturated. ChatPersona’s competitors include tools such as FlirtFlowChatterCharms and Botly. For example, startup Supercreator offers a whole suite of solutions, including message automation and algorithms for prioritizing high-paying users.

One use case is a feature that sends messages to long-dormant fans as soon as they log in. Such automation has already yielded impressive results, such as a thousand-dollar tip after an AI-generated first contact.

Experts and creators’ opinions

Ex-creator of OnlyFans, now head of agency Heiss Talent, said she uses Supercreator’s tools for all of her clients. She has seen a significant increase in sales thanks to the AI’s ability to target users based on their activity and ability to pay. While automation plays a key role, creators prefer to add personal details to messages to maintain a sense of genuine communication.
